- Developmental Screening: Often, the process begins with a developmental screening during routine well-child visits. Pediatricians use standardized questionnaires to assess a child's development, looking for red flags. If there are any concerns, the child will be referred for a more in-depth evaluation.
- Comprehensive Evaluation: This evaluation is conducted by a team of professionals, which might include a pediatrician, a psychologist, a psychiatrist, a speech-language pathologist, or an occupational therapist. They will gather information through observations, interviews, and assessments.
- Observations: The professionals observe the person's behavior in different settings, like at home or in a clinic. They'll look at social interactions, communication skills, and patterns of behavior.
- Interviews: Parents or caregivers are interviewed to gather information about the person's developmental history, current behaviors, and any concerns they have.
- Assessments: Standardized assessments are used to evaluate specific skills, like communication, social skills, and cognitive abilities.
- Diagnostic Criteria: The professionals use the diagnostic criteria from the Diagnostic and Statistical Manual of Mental Disorders (DSM-5) to determine if a person meets the criteria for ASD. The DSM-5 outlines the specific symptoms and behaviors that are characteristic of ASD.
- Differential Diagnosis: It's important to rule out other conditions that might have similar symptoms. Other conditions include intellectual disability, ADHD, and social communication disorder. The assessment team carefully evaluates all the information collected and provides a comprehensive report with a diagnosis, if appropriate. The report includes recommendations for intervention and support. Early diagnosis is key. It allows families to access support and services as soon as possible, which can make a real difference in the child's development.
- Parent/Caregiver Interviews: These are a vital part of the process. Professionals ask detailed questions about the child's development, behavior, and any concerns parents or caregivers may have. They may be asked about the child's communication skills, social interactions, and repetitive behaviors.
- Direct Observation: Clinicians observe the child's behavior in different settings. This might include structured play, social interactions, and daily activities. They’re looking for specific behaviors and patterns that might indicate ASD.
- Standardized Assessments: Standardized assessments are designed to measure specific skills and abilities. Some common assessments include:
- Autism Diagnostic Observation Schedule, Second Edition (ADOS-2): This is a standardized assessment that involves observing the child in structured social situations. It assesses communication, social interaction, and play skills.
- Autism Diagnostic Interview-Revised (ADI-R): This is a structured interview with parents or caregivers that gathers information about the child's developmental history and behavior.
- Childhood Autism Rating Scale, Second Edition (CARS-2): This is a rating scale that assesses the severity of autism symptoms. The scale rates behaviors such as relating to people, imitation, emotional response, and body use.
- Developmental Screenings: Screening tools, such as the Modified Checklist for Autism in Toddlers, Revised with Follow-Up (M-CHAT-R/F), help identify children who may be at risk for ASD. This screening process helps determine whether a comprehensive evaluation is needed.
- Speech and Language Assessments: These assessments help evaluate a child's communication skills, including their ability to speak, understand language, and use nonverbal communication. The speech-language pathologist will assess a child's speech and language skills.
- Cognitive Assessments: Cognitive assessments evaluate a child's cognitive abilities, such as problem-solving and reasoning skills. Psychologists often administer these assessments to measure the child's intelligence quotient (IQ) and adaptive skills.

- Applied Behavior Analysis (ABA): ABA is a type of therapy based on the principles of learning and behavior. It uses positive reinforcement to teach new skills and reduce challenging behaviors. ABA can be adapted to meet the individual's needs, whether focusing on a specific skill or addressing challenging behaviors. ABA can be really effective in helping individuals with ASD develop skills. This includes communication, social interaction, and daily living skills.
- Speech Therapy: Speech therapy helps individuals improve their communication skills. This can include speech production, language comprehension, and social communication. Speech therapists help individuals develop their ability to communicate effectively, which is essential for social interaction and overall well-being.
- Occupational Therapy (OT): Occupational therapy helps individuals develop the skills needed to participate in everyday activities. This can include fine motor skills, sensory processing, and self-care skills. OTs might also focus on sensory integration therapy. This therapy helps individuals manage sensory sensitivities and develop strategies for coping with sensory overload.
- Physical Therapy: Physical therapy focuses on improving gross motor skills, coordination, and strength. It can be particularly helpful for individuals with ASD who have motor difficulties.
- Social Skills Training: Social skills training teaches individuals how to interact with others in social situations. This might include topics like making friends, understanding social cues, and managing conflict. Social skills training can be done in group settings or one-on-one sessions.
- Medication: There are no medications to treat the core symptoms of ASD. However, medication can be used to manage associated symptoms, such as anxiety, depression, and ADHD. Medications can help stabilize mood, reduce hyperactivity, and improve focus.
- Educational Interventions: Children with ASD often benefit from specialized educational programs. These programs provide a structured learning environment, individualized instruction, and support. Educational interventions include things like Individualized Education Programs (IEPs), which are tailored to the child's specific needs.

- Genetics Research: Scientists are exploring the genetic basis of ASD. They are studying how genes and environmental factors interact to increase the risk of ASD. The goal is to identify genetic markers that can be used for early diagnosis and targeted treatments.
- Brain Imaging: Brain imaging techniques, such as MRI and fMRI, are used to study brain structure and function in people with ASD. They help scientists understand the differences in brain connectivity, which might be related to social and communication difficulties.
- Early Intervention Studies: Researchers are evaluating the effectiveness of early intervention programs. The focus is on the impact of these programs on children's development, especially on social communication and cognitive skills.
- Pharmacological Interventions: Researchers are studying the effectiveness of medications in treating symptoms associated with ASD. Medications are helpful in treating anxiety, ADHD, and other co-occurring conditions.
- Sensory Processing: Sensory processing is often atypical in people with ASD. Scientists are investigating sensory sensitivities. They are also developing interventions to help people manage these challenges.
- Artificial Intelligence (AI): AI is used in several ways. Scientists are using AI to analyze data and to develop diagnostic tools.
- Telehealth: Telehealth allows for remote access to therapy and support services. It is becoming increasingly popular. It helps to improve access to care, especially for people in rural areas.
- Adult Autism Research: There’s more and more research focused on the challenges faced by adults with ASD. Researchers are trying to identify strategies that can help adults live independently. This research is also focused on helping with employment and social integration.
- Comorbidity Research: Research is focused on understanding the co-occurrence of ASD with other conditions. The conditions include anxiety, depression, and ADHD. Understanding Autism Spectrum Disorder
First off, what exactly is Autism Spectrum Disorder? Think of it as a neurodevelopmental condition that impacts how a person interacts with the world. It affects communication, social interaction, and behavior. The term “spectrum” is key here, because ASD presents itself differently in each person. Some might experience mild challenges, while others face more significant hurdles. It's a spectrum, which means a wide range of presentations and severity levels. Symptoms and Early Signs
Recognizing the symptoms of Autism Spectrum Disorder can be critical. Early detection makes a big difference. Parents and caregivers should keep an eye out for certain signs. These signs include difficulties with social interaction, challenges with communication, and repetitive behaviors or restricted interests. For example, a child might not respond to their name, avoid eye contact, or have trouble understanding social cues. They might also repeat words or phrases, or have an intense focus on certain objects or topics. Early signs can sometimes appear as early as 12 to 18 months, which is why monitoring a child's development is so important. Watch out for a lack of shared interest. This is when a child doesn't share their interests or activities with others. Also, it’s about a lack of social reciprocity. This is when a child struggles to respond to the emotions of others. Another sign is repetitive behaviors, such as rocking, hand-flapping, or lining up toys. It’s also important to note the changes of sensory sensitivities. This is when a child is overly sensitive to sounds, lights, or textures. Recognizing these signs doesn't automatically mean a diagnosis, but it warrants a visit to a healthcare professional. They can conduct a thorough evaluation to provide an accurate assessment. The evaluation will likely involve observations, interviews with parents or caregivers, and standardized assessments. Causes of Autism Spectrum Disorder: What the Science Says
Okay, so what causes Autism Spectrum Disorder? Well, that's a question scientists are still actively working on, but we have some pretty good leads. It's generally accepted that ASD is caused by a combination of genetic and environmental factors. Think of it like a complex puzzle where multiple pieces need to fit together. Genetics play a significant role. Studies have identified numerous genes associated with ASD. It's not usually a single gene, but rather a combination of genes that contribute to the risk. If you have a family history of autism, there's a higher chance of a child being diagnosed, which emphasizes the genetic component. Genes are not the whole story, though! Environmental factors are also believed to play a role. These might include things like exposure to certain toxins during pregnancy, complications during birth, or even the mother's health. The environment doesn't cause autism in the same way a virus causes a cold. However, it can influence how genes are expressed and increase the risk. Researchers are also exploring the role of the immune system and the gut microbiome in ASD. The gut microbiome is the community of microorganisms living in your gut. There's a growing body of evidence suggesting a link between gut health and brain function, which could have implications for autism. The Role of Genetics and Environment
We've touched on this, but let's dive deeper. The interplay between genetics and environment is super important. Think of genetics as the blueprint, and the environment as the construction site. Your genes provide the basic plan, but your environment shapes the final outcome. Several genes have been linked to an increased risk of autism. Some of these genes affect brain development, communication, and social behavior. Researchers are using advanced techniques to study these genes and understand their impact. The environment can influence the way these genes are expressed. For example, exposure to certain chemicals during pregnancy could affect brain development in a way that increases the risk of ASD. The timing of environmental exposures matters, too. Some exposures might be more critical during certain periods of development. This is why research into prenatal and early childhood exposures is so important. This includes looking at factors like air quality, nutrition, and exposure to infectious agents. Scientists are also studying epigenetic modifications. This is changes in gene expression that are not caused by changes in the DNA sequence itself. These modifications can be influenced by environmental factors. It's like turning a switch on or off for a particular gene. The goal is to understand how these factors interact to influence the risk of ASD. The goal is to identify ways to mitigate environmental risks and support healthy development.
